Micro hydroelectric power refers to small-scale hydropower systems, typically generating up to 100 kW, used for localized electricity generation in rural, remote, and off-grid areas. Micro hydro systems are environmentally friendly, cost-effective, and provide reliable energy for households, small industries, and community facilities.

• Rising Demand for Renewable Energy
Governments and industries are adopting clean energy solutions to reduce carbon emissions and meet sustainability targets.
• Focus on Rural Electrification & Off-grid Solutions
Micro hydro systems provide reliable electricity to remote regions where grid access is limited or unavailable.
• Technological Advancements in Turbines & Generators
Improved turbine designs, digital controls, and modular systems enhance efficiency, performance, and ease of installation.
• Supportive Government Policies & Incentives
Subsidies, grants, and favorable regulations encourage investment in small-scale hydropower projects.
